Neighborhood Overview
Covenant Keepers Charter School is situated in the southern part of Little Rock, Arkansas, near the Geyer Springs Road corridor. This location provides a balance between residential calm and accessible urban amenities, making it a practical spot for families and teams. The primary access route is Geyer Springs Road itself, a major thoroughfare connecting to broader city networks. Driving from the nearest major airport, Bill and Hillary Clinton National Airport (LIT), typically takes about 20-30 minutes depending on traffic, primarily utilizing I-440 East to I-30 West. Parking at the school is usually available on campus, with specific areas designated for visitors, though it can become busy during peak event times. Public transportation options are limited but can be accessed via routes that serve the main roads in the vicinity, with rideshares being a more convenient alternative for direct campus access. Smart arrival tactics involve checking the school’s event calendar to anticipate crowds and aiming to arrive at least 30 minutes before scheduled activities to allow ample time for parking and finding your way around campus.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Little Rock is generally cool to cold, with average high temperatures in the 40s and 50s Fahrenheit. Visitors should pack layers, including sweaters, jackets, and perhaps a heavier coat for colder days. Outdoor activities may require extra warmth, and arriving early to warm up inside is advised. Road conditions can be slick if ice or snow occurs, so allow extra travel time.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ings mild to warm temperatures, typically ranging from the 60s to 70s Fahrenheit, with increasing humidity as summer approaches. Light jackets or sweaters are usually sufficient for cooler mornings and evenings. Pack comfortable walking shoes and consider bringing an umbrella for spring showers. Outdoor events are generally pleasant, but be prepared for occasional rain.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er is characterized by high heat and humidity, with daytime temperatures frequently exceeding the 90s Fahrenheit and feeling hotter with humidity.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ential. Stay hydrated by carrying water, especially for outdoor events. Seek shade during peak sun hours, and plan for indoor or less strenuous activities during the hottest parts of the day.
Fall season
Fall offers some of the most pleasant weather, with temperatures gradually cooling from the 70s into the 50s Fahrenheit. Days are often sunny and crisp, making it ideal for outdoor events. Pack layers, including long sleeves and a light jacket, as evenings can become cool. This season is excellent for exploring the area on foot and enjoying comfortable outdoor activities.
Rain & snow
Rain is possible throughout the year but can be more frequent in spring and fall. Snow is less common but can occur during winter months, sometimes causing travel disruptions. During wet or snowy conditions, prioritize comfortable, waterproof footwear and warm, protective outerwear. Be sure to check weather forecasts close to your travel date and adjust plans as needed, allowing for potential delays due to weather.
